2014-08-28 3 views
0

Mac OS와 번들로 제공되는 PHP를 사용하여 PHP 응용 프로그램을 실행하고 싶습니다. 지금 난 내 사용자 정의 PHP 애플리케이션을 유지해야PHP를 MAC OS 번들로 구성

/Library/WebServer/Documents/index.html.en 

에서 사용 가능한 페이지를 보여줍니다 나는 약간의 변화를 수행하고 그 후 나는

sudo apachectl 

다시 시작 및 실행 로컬 호스트를 사용하여 내 아파치 서버를 시작했습니다 그것을 할 수 있도록 localhost의 브라우저에서 볼 수 있어야합니다. 당신은 파일과 심볼릭 링크에 액세스 할 수있는 아파치 사용자를 확보하여 해당 차지하고 있는지 확인

ln -s /Users/NewBee/Desktop/mycustomappinanaccessibleplace /Library/WebServer/Documents/my_app 

사용 권한 문제로 실행할 수 있습니다 :

+1

'/ Library/WebServer/Documents'에 저장 한 페이지가'http : // localhost /'...에 나타나면 커스텀 PHP 애플리케이션을'/ Library/웹 서버/문서'? 나는 또한 로컬 스택에 대해 [MAMP] (http://www.mamp.info/en/)를 제안 할 것을 제안했다. – sjagr

+0

사용자 사이트를 가질 수 있었던 이전 Mac OS X 버전의 기능이있었습니다. 홈 디렉토리의 Sites 디렉토리에 파일을 저장하면'http : // localhost/~ username'을 통해 액세스 할 수 있습니다. 이 기능을 다시 사용할 수는 있지만 그 부분을 조사해야 할 것입니다. –

+0

@sjagr : 맞습니다. 그러나 거기에 넣고 싶지는 않지만 쉽게 액세스 할 수있는 곳이 있습니다. – NewBee

답변

0

보다 쉽게 ​​접근 경로가 심볼릭 링크를 사용합니다.

다른 옵션은 httpd.conf 파일의 DocumentRoot을 변경하는 것입니다.